Live
Today at
Oprah Live Stream
Remind Me
Loading...

Specialist, Integrated Marketing (Temporary CW Assignment)

Location: New York, NY
Date Posted: 05-18-2017
OWN is the first and only network named for, and inspired by, a single iconic leader. Oprah Winfrey's heart and creative instincts inform the brand - and the  magnetism of the channel. Winfrey provides leadership in programming and attracts superstar talent to join her in primetime, building a global community of like-minded viewers and leading that community to connect on social media and beyond. OWN is a singular destination on cable. Depth with edge. Heart. Star power. Connection. And endless possibilities. OWN is a joint venture between Harpo, Inc. and Discovery Communications. The network debuted on January 1, 2011 and is available in 85 million homes. The venture also includes the award-winning digital platform Oprah.com.

POSITION SUMMARY

The Specialist works across all Integrated Marketing related sales development activities, including tracking, contributing to and driving pitches from conception and development through to post-sale. Specialist is expected to assist the Integrated Marketing Team and also work cross-functionally with Marketing, Sales, Digital/Social, Media Planning, Programming, and Ad Ops teams to ensure proper vetting and excellence across all proposals and materials. This is a contingent worker (CW – temporary) assignment for six months, with the potential for further extension.

RESPONSIBILITIES

The ideal candidate is detail-oriented, organized team-player with a passion for integrated marketing.
  • Participates in brainstorm sessions to assist in writing and designing responses RFP-based opportunities 
  • Manages custom integrated digital/social campaign process in all areas including ideation and execution
  • Coordinates efforts for integrated digital/social campaigns with editorial, design, sales, pricing and operations teams for smooth execution
  • Supports design aesthetic for presentations that represents both the brand and network tonality
  • Develops timelines moving against feedback needs for assigned projects
  • Inputs, tracks and updates all active pitches
 
QUALIFICATIONS

Candidate should have the following to be considered for the role in the NY OWN Office: 
  • A minimum of 3-4 years of marketing experience, preferably integrated and with network or digital publisher background
  • Passion for creating custom content and native opportunities within the on-air and digital space
  • Graphic design and basic HTML knowledge a plus
  • Digital Ad Sales basic knowledge preferred
  • Excellent organization and written communication skills
  • Attentive to deadlines, detail oriented, proven project management skills (organization, timeline creation and management, follow through)
  • Familiarity with content management systems and project management programs preferred (TeamSite, JIRA, Confluence, Basecamp)
  • Bachelor’s Degree in related field


OWN, LLC is an Equal Opportunity Employer. It is our policy to provide equal employment opportunities to all employees and applicants for employment without regard to race, color, religion, creed, national origin, gender, sexual orientation, age, gender identity, marital status, citizenship, disability, genetic information or veteran status or any other basis prohibited by applicable federal, state or local law.
 
or
this job portal is powered by CATS